Babajide Sanwo-Olu, governor of Lagos, says the state has secured a partnership with the African Export-Import Bank and Access Bank for an infrastructure investment of $1.352 billion.on Tuesday, said the state signed a partnership deal with the two banks at the second Africaribbean Trade and Investment Forum 2023 in Georgetown, Guyana.

“This investment will power our long-term infrastructure projects, demonstrating confidence from international and local partners in our growing economy. As we move forward, this investment will help us realise key projects, including the Fourth Mainland Bridge, Omu Creek Project, and the 2nd Phase of the LRMT Blue Line from Mile 2 to Okokomaiko.

“We’re committed to creating a better future for Lagos and its people. Our vision for Lagos is becoming a reality with the Lekki-Epe International Airport and the Lagos Food Systems and Logistics Hub in Epe.“These projects will further boost our economy and serve generations to come.
